Center defect in my hairline just came on 1 year ago when I turned 23

It is not unusual for the hairline to mature and lose the frontal 3/4 inch upward. I call this a maturing hairline but it is not always uniform and it can start in the center anytime between the ages of 18-29 years. This can also be a sign of genetic balding but your hairline looks flat and low. You should see a doctor to determine just where this is coming from. The doctor will perform both a HAIRCHECK test of your entire scalp and miniaturization studies of your frontal hairline.

Celiac Disease and Hair Loss

doctor,
you answer most topics, however I cannot find any information about CELIAC DISEASE and HAIRLOSS. It is scattered all over the web, however the link, to me, is not clear. I am 20. and have diffuse hairloss, my doctor told me to take omega 369 and jarodophillus. and to not drink beer, or eat wheat. is this good advice, considering the link between cleliac disease and hairloss?

Hair loss associated with celiac disease can be related to its link to alopecia areata, and can also be a result of the nutritional deficiency caused by the disease itself. The treatment for celiac disease is to remove gluten from your diet and to address the malnutrition caused by the disease. It sounds like your primary care physician is right on track with his recommendation for treatment. Once this has been addressed the question will be whether your hair loss was caused by alopecia areata, a nutritional deficiency, or both. A good source of information on this disease is the Celiac Disease Foundation. Good luck.
